Red Mess is a Stoner Rock trio that was formed in 2013 in Londrina, Brazil. Douglas (drums) and Thiago (guitar), who have known each other since childhood, found the band’s structure solidified with the arrival of bassist Lucas, transforming Red Mess into one of the most exciting bands in the Brazilian underground rock scene. The band’s musical style sits at the intersection of Progressive and Stoner Rock, drawing influence from the raw, gritty energy of the Brazilian underground.
In 2017, Red Mess was invited to join Ukrainian Stoner Rock band Stoned Jesus on their Brazil tour. Now, the band is focusing on expanding its presence in Europe, having released three EPs ("Crimson" 2014, "Drowning in Red" 2015, "Phantom Limb" 2022) and an album, "Into the Mess" (2017), all under Brazil’s Abraxas Records. Their latest album, "Breathtaker" (2022), is being released by All Good Clean Records in Norway, coinciding with their first European tour in the fall of 2022.
Known for their explosive live shows, Red Mess brings a raw, emotional intensity to the stage, an experience that has become central to their identity. Producer Galego Teixeira, who witnessed numerous Red Mess concerts in sweltering Brazilian bars, captured the band's unpolished, visceral sound on the album "Breathtaker," successfully transferring that same energy into the recordings.
